THE IMPLEMENTATION OF LEGAL RISK MANAGEMENT IN COMPANIES RELATED TO EARNINGS MANAGEMENT OF MANUFACTURING COMPANIES IN THE CONSUMER GOODS INDUSTRY SECTOR LISTED ON THE INDONESIA STOCK EXCHANGE Pasaribu, Dompak; Sinaga, Silvia Shania

Abstract

This study adopts a socio-legal approach, which is a non-doctrinal method in legal research, to explore the role of Directors in implementing legal risk management and earnings management post-COVID-19 pandemic. The research method integrates various disciplines to gather empirical data needed to address research questions focused on practical issues, policies, and legal changes. This non-doctrinal research combines qualitative and quantitative aspects using empirical data to analyze the impact of effective legal risk management on the financial performance and reputation of manufacturing companies in the consumer goods industry sector during the COVID-19 pandemic. Through comprehensive empirical data collection, this study aims to provide an in-depth understanding of the role of Directors in managing legal risks and earnings management and their impact on the financial performance and reputation of companies during the pandemic crisis. Findings from this research are expected to provide valuable insights for legal practitioners, corporate management, and researchers to develop effective strategies in addressing challenges faced by manufacturing companies in the consumer goods industry sector during the COVID-19 pandemic.
